Thief comes up empty-handed after using stolen tractor to remove ATM

Someone used a stolen tractor to remove a standalone ATM from a bank in Brentwood early Friday morning, according to police.

Officers responded around 4:40 a.m. to an alarm at the Wells Fargo bank at 2540 Sand Creek Road, with witnesses reporting the ATM was removed from in front of the bank, causing significant damage to the building, police said.

Investigators determined the tractor had been stolen from a nearby construction site and it was found abandoned in an open field at the dead-end of Sand Creek Road west of state Highway 4. The ATM vault was found about 100 yards west of the bank and was intact with no money removed from it, according to police.

Brentwood police have not made an arrest or released any suspect information in the case and are asking anyone with information to call the department at (925) 809-7911.
